Procedural Posture

Evidentiary Ruling (on Admissibility of Statement Paragraphs)

  1. 1 ["Whether paragraphs 48 to 69 of Mr Harvey Hilman's statement should be rejected as irrelevant evidence"]

Ratio Decidendi

It is premature to reject evidence as irrelevant if it can be reasonably argued that it may give rise to an inference supporting the applicants' case, so the challenged paragraphs will not be rejected as a group at this stage.

Court Disposition

Application to reject paragraphs 48 to 69 of the statement as a group is refused.

Orders

  • ["Paragraphs 48 to 69 of Mr Harvey Hilman's statement will not be rejected in globo; each paragraph will be dealt with specifically."]
